Output 51e2932f3f2db5e029ab6ad0d7ce6694ca5e10f0b5608aa0575e469463e6654d:0

value
6961493444144
script pubkey
OP_0 OP_PUSHBYTES_20 313920d177281a38a2ec43d5b191e004266e1256
address
tb1qxyujp5th9qdr3ghvg02mry0qqsnxuyjk76m55r
transaction
51e2932f3f2db5e029ab6ad0d7ce6694ca5e10f0b5608aa0575e469463e6654d
confirmations
170299
spent
true